Buhari Appoints Muiz Banire As AMCON Chair, 13 Others For FCSC

51-year old, Muiz Adeyemi Banire who is a lawyer and activist that served as three-term commissioner of Lagos State has been given a political appointment.

Dr. Muiz Banire
 
President Muhammadu Buhari has appointed a former Legal Adviser of the ruling All Progressives Congress, Dr. Muiz Banire, as Chairman of the Governing Board of the Assets Management Corporation of Nigeria.
 
Banire is a Senior Advocate of Nigeria.
 
The President also appointed the chairman and 12 commissioners of the Federal Civil Service Commission.
 
President of the Senate, Bukola Saraki, at the plenary on Tuesday, read Buhari’s letters to the legislature in which he sought the approval of the chamber.
